President Trump has announced a third extension—this time for 90 days—to the June 19 deadline requiring ByteDance to sell TikTok’s U.S. operations under national security concerns. The White House aims to secure a divestiture that safeguards American user data, though legal experts question the legitimacy of multiple extensions beyond the one allowed by law.
